Area contextNeighborhood Overview – The Show Place Arena (Upper Marlboro, MD)
Nestled in Upper Marlboro, Maryland, The Show Place Arena benefits from its location within Prince George's County, offering a balance between suburban tranquility and proximity to major metropolitan hubs. The venue is strategically situated off Pennsylvania Avenue, a key thoroughfare that provides direct access to Interstate 495 (the Capital Beltway) and various state routes, facilitating travel for those arriving by car. For those flying in, Baltimore/Washington International Thurgood Marshall Airport (BWI) is typically the closest major airport, usually reachable within a 30-45 minute drive depending on traffic.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A) and Washington Dulles International Airport (IAD) are also viable options, though often with longer travel times. Public transportation options are somewhat limited directly to the arena, making rideshares or personal vehicles the most common modes of transport. Planning your arrival is crucial; aim to be in the vicinity at least 30-45 minutes prior to any scheduled event, especially during peak hours or popular event days, to account for potential traffic congestion on Pennsylvania Avenue and surrounding roads as visitors converge on the venue.

Things to Do Near The Show Place Arena
Walkable
Prince George's Sports and Learning Complex
Adjacent to The Show Place Arena, this expansive facility offers more than just a place for athletic competitions; it features a public indoor track, fitness center, and aquatic facilities. It's a versatile spot for active individuals or families looking for an indoor workout or a place to swim. The complex often hosts various sports programs and public access hours, making it a convenient option for a quick recreational stop before or after an event at the arena, especially if weather is a concern or if you have extra time to fill.

Weather & Seasons at The Show Place Arena
- Winter: Winter in Upper Marlboro typically brings chilly to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s Fahrenheit. Visitors should pack warm layers, including coats, hats, and gloves, especially for evening events. Snowfall is possible, which can occasionally impact travel conditions, so checking road reports before departing is wise. Indoor event spaces at the arena offer a comfortable escape from the cold.
- Spring & early summer: Spring ushers in milder weather with temperatures gradually warming into the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it. Light jackets or sweaters are generally sufficient for comfortable outdoor movement. This season is ideal for both indoor arena events and potentially outdoor activities in the surrounding areas. Pack for variable conditions, as late spring can still see occasional cooler days or rain showers.
- Mid-summer: Summers are warm to hot and humid, with daytime temperatures often reaching the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Light, breathable clothing is recommended. Hydration is key, so bring water bottles if permitted or plan to purchase them inside. While indoor arena spaces are climate-controlled, travel to and from the venue may require navigating the heat.
- Fall season: Fall brings pleasant, crisp weather as temperatures cool into the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it. It’s a comfortable time for attending events, with a need for light layers like sweaters or jackets. Outdoor exploration in the surrounding region becomes more appealing, but early mornings and evenings can be cool, so dressing in layers is advisable for comfort.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round, with heavier rainfall often occurring in spring and summer. Snow is most likely during the winter months. Visitors should always check the weather forecast before traveling and pack accordingly. Umbrellas or rain gear are useful during wet periods, and waterproof footwear is recommended. Snow can cause travel delays, so allow extra time and monitor road conditions if winter weather is expected.
